Autumn in Sweden is a mushroom lover's paradise! 🍂 And the best part? Thanks to 'allemansrätten', also known as the Right of Public Access, everyone has the freedom to wander around and pick mushrooms in the Swedish wilderness. Sweden is home to around 10,000 different types of mushroom, about 100 of which are edible. The most popular edible mushroom in Sweden is probably the golden chanterelle. Here are 5 quick tips before you go mushroom hunting in Sweden: 🌂 Look for mushrooms on cloudy days – then they're easier to spot than on sunny days. 🧺 Use a basket or paper bag, not plastic bags, to collect mushrooms – this is both to avoid squishing them and to avoid the growth of bacteria. 🥾 Wear waterproof boots for your mushroom adventure. 👫 Bring company – mushroom picking is more fun when you do it together, and it increases your chances of finding lots of mushrooms. 🍄 Most importantly: Only pick mushrooms that you know are edible!
